Why this page exists

Buyers in this market now ask a harder question

Not “what does it do?” — “will you exist next year?” After two platform shutdowns in this space, that’s the right question, and it deserves a straight answer instead of a logo wall.

Ours: Evensteer is independent and revenue-funded — no venture clock forcing a sale or a shutdown. Pricing is flat and written into your scope. Your data is exportable from day one: your site, your client list, your pipeline, your contracts, your content. If we ever part ways, you leave with everything. We’d rather earn the renewal than lock the door.

An agency retainer that stopped making sense

A boutique agency runs $24,000 a year; done-for-you tiers start at $500 a month and are built for businesses doing $30K+ monthly. The middle ground — a specialist plus software, everything approved by you — is the category we run. Same work, without the overhead you were really paying for.

What the move includes

Migration is onboarding, not a project

Client list, contracts, calendar, content, and domains come over as part of setup. Nothing goes dark mid-move: your site stays up, your booked sessions stay booked, and every inquiry that lands during the switch still gets answered in minutes — that habit starts on day one, not after launch.

You get a written scope with a fixed price before anything starts, and a named specialist who answers for the move end to end.
